AfterPay to Drop Buy Now Pay Later NFT Keys at New York Fashion Week

Five fashion designers will debut NFTs at September’s NYFW that unlock access to exclusive experiences in real life.

Afterpay, an Australian fintech company best known for its buy now, pay later service, has partnered with global sports, events and talent management company, IMG, to bring NFTs to the fashion crowd at this September’s New York Fashion Week (NYFW).

The partnership is in its third season running, and this time, AfterPay has joined forces with five fashion designers to drop NFT keys that unlock exclusive access to real-life experiences. AfterPay is also the official presenting partner of New York Fashion Week: The Shows.

Each NFT is a phygital collectible that will retail for $100 and buyers can purchase the NFTs by splitting the payment into four interest-free installments on Keys.NYFW.com. 

The designers drew inspiration from their Spring/Summer ’23 collections to create their unique NFTs alongside a selection of limited edition products or traditionally unobtainable NYFW experiences.

Those who purchase Joseph Altuzarra’s NFT key will receive a special edition logo tote and oversized t-shirt or annual membership to one of New York City’s premiere art museums, while AnOnlyChild’s NFTs grants holders an exclusive invite to AnOnlyChild NYFW after-party or a limited edition belt bag.

Jonathan Simkhai’s NFT will offer access to a private meet-and-greet shopping experience with Simkhai or original, signed runway sketches from his new collection debuting Sep 13. Kim Shui’s NFT comes with a custom-designed hoodie incorporating Kim’s signature dragon motif or tickets to her runway show on Sep 12 while buyers of The Blonds’ NFT will receive an exclusive invite to The Blonds’ NYFW after party or a signed copy of The Blonds: Glamour, Fashion, Fantasy forthcoming book.

All proceeds from the sale of the designer NFT Keys will be donated to Free Arts NYC, bringing art and mentoring programs to children in underserved communities in New York City.

Besides collaborating with fashion designers to launch NFTs, AfterPay will also be issuing its first-ever free NFT in a limited quantity. Consumers can mint the NFTs to unlock utilities like a TIDAL HiFi Plus 6-Month Free Trial, access to an NYFW close-friends Instagram group, and an invitation to RSVP to NYFW: The Talks sessions.

The fashion industry has embraced Web3 this year with the debut of Metaverse Fashion Week this March while a number of fashion brands have launched NFTs and metaverse experiences. Last season, Clearpay (AfterPay’s Europe Division) teamed up with British designer Roksanda Ilincic to release NFT and AR digital wearable versions of a hero look from her Fall ‘22 collection.

Buy now pay later services for NFTs have also made their debut this year, such as the one from Teller and Halliday.

Both the designer NFT Keys and the free Afterpay NFT will be hosted on the Polygon network, and available in limited quantities beginning Aug 23.
